ISIL-Saudi Arabia appears on 4 distinct sanctions and screening lists across multiple jurisdictions, indicating broad international consensus on restriction.
SAM.gov records show active exclusions for ISIL-Saudi Arabia, indicating federal debarment from US government contracts and procurement.
Hijaz and Asir Provinces, Najd region; Kuwait; Hijaz and Asir Provinces, Najd region Saudi Arabia
| Also Known As |
|---|
| ISIS in Saudi Arabia |
| Hijaz Province of the Islamic State |
| Islamic State of Iraq and the Levant in Saudi Arabia |
| AL-HIJAZ PROVINCE |
| PROVINCE OF THE TWO HOLY PLACES |
| Islamic State of Iraq and the Levant-Saudi Arabia |
| Wilayat al-Haramayn |
| Mujahideen of the Arabian Peninsula |
| Al-Hijaz Province |
| Province of the Two Holy Places |
| Wilayat Najd |
| Najd Province |
